gentilu 10-11-2011 12:56

Quote:

Originally Posted by pakrat2k2 (Post 398006)

Filename: {src}\DirectX\DXSETUP.exe; Parameters: /silent; StatusMsg: {cm:run} Microsoft DirectX...; Tasks: DirectX

Directive or parameter "Tasks" expression error: Parameter "Tasks" includes an unknown task.

//What is the problem?

pakrat2k2 10-11-2011 16:38

just remove the Tasks: Directx from end of line.

the error message means that you have no list of tasks in the iss script..

janek2012 18-11-2011 11:58

Quote:

Originally Posted by MartinezPL (Post 398295)
Hello i got a problem
I start setup select language click next...
and i got this error
http://fotosik.org/images/66112139722927496825.jpg
OS:Windows XP SP3 any ideas guys?:)
My script file

mciSendString() function causes crash on Windows XP - Replace all (2) "PlayMusic()" instances with "//PlayMusic()" and delete background music from source and rebuild.
Note that it will disable music on startup.
You should also delete music in setup.cab so user will not play it by himself.

This is a temporary solution because I am not sure how to play music on Windows XP.
